    Most varieties of this succulent thrive in small containers, blooming even with restricted root room. For hybrids that require larger containers, repot only when the plant has outgrown its current space. Utilize a rich, well-drained planting medium, such as a commercial cactus mix amended with perlite, pumice, sharp sand, or gravel, and a little extra composted manure for optimal growth. Positioning the plant lower in the ground can help manage its height and conceal any graft unions.

    Pruning is essential for maintaining the plant’s shape and size. Always use a clean knife to prevent the milky sap from gumming up cutting implements. Exercise caution due to the sap’s potential to cause dermatitis and the plant’s sharp thorns. Cut stems back to axillary buds to encourage branching or remove entire branches to open up the plant. Regular pruning promotes vigor, especially in species varieties, ensuring a healthy and thriving specimen.

    This plant thrives in a bright location with some morning or evening sun. Warmth and light encourage abundant summer blooms, while consistent temperatures can hinder growth. Ensure adequate sunlight to prevent over-watering and root rot. Water thoroughly between droughts, allowing the soil to dry completely. Be vigilant for signs of under-watering, such as shriveled stems and yellowing leaves, to maintain its lush appearance.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    • What is the ideal pot size for this succulent? Most varieties thrive in small containers, but some hybrids may need larger pots as they mature.
    • How often should I water my plant? Water thoroughly only when the soil is completely dry, reducing frequency in autumn and winter.
    • What type of soil is best for this plant? A well-draining cactus mix amended with perlite, pumice, sharp sand, or gravel is ideal.
    • How much sunlight does this plant need? This plant prefers a bright location with a few hours of direct sunlight each day.
    • Is this plant poisonous? Yes, the milky sap is poisonous if ingested and can cause skin irritation, so handle with care.
